Billy Elliot the Musical
is now playing at the Victoria Palace theatre
to rave reviews. Based on the film of the same name, and set in a
northern England mining town during the 1984 miners’ strikes, it tells
the story of a young boy who follows his heart to take up ballet lessons
instead of more traditonal boxing lessons, despite lacking the support
of his widowed father and brother. With hit music from Sir Elton John,
this is a truly uplifing tale of hope and happiness. Tickets from £19.50.
